In this section, show potential investors what your specific marketing and sales targets are and how you plan to
achieve them. Talk about how you will sell your product or service. Research the best methods for reaching your
audience and convincing them to buy your product. Highlight how you are offering something new or how you
can fix a problem in the industry. Understand the purchasing priorities of your audience and try to leverage that
behavior.
    
Product
The brand, its features, its packaging

What needs does this product fulfill
What frustrations does it address?
What makes it compelling to customers that they will want to have it?

Price
 Discounts, bundles, credit terms

What is the value of the product or service to customers?


Are there established price points for this product or service in the market?
How will this price compare with competitors?

Promotion
 Print & broadcast ads, social media, email, search engine, video

How you will get the word out about your product or service?
What promotional approaches are most familiar to your audience?
What resources are available to you?

Place
 Physical stores, website, online marketplace

Will it be in a physical store or online?


Where will the stores be?
What will be the distribution channels?
